Amphenol ICC 91615-312 Rectangular Connector - Equivalent & Substitute Parts
Part Overview
The Amphenol ICC 91615-312 is a 24-position receptacle connector in the Dubox™ series, designed for board-to-board applications with 0.100" (2.54mm) pitch spacing. This surface mount connector features gold-plated mating contacts, push-pull fastening, and board lock functionality. The part is currently listed as obsolete, making identification of suitable substitutes essential for ongoing production and maintenance applications. The primary substitute maintains identical electrical and mechanical specifications while offering improved compliance status and active product availability.

Substitute Part Grouping Explanation
Substitution eligibility for the 91615-312 is determined by strict equivalence across the following critical parameters:
- Connector geometry and pitch: 24-position, 0.100" (2.54mm) mating pitch, 2-row configuration with 0.100" row spacing
- Contact system: Female socket contacts with gold mating finish (30.0µin thickness) and tin post finish (78.7µin thickness)
- Mounting and termination: Surface mount with solder termination
- Mechanical interface: Push-pull fastening with board lock feature
- Physical envelope: 10.81mm mated stacking height, 0.275" (6.99mm) insulation height
- Material and safety: Thermoplastic glass-filled insulation, UL94 V-0 flammability rating
The substitute part 91615-312LF maintains complete equivalence across all these parameters. The primary difference is product status and regulatory compliance, not functional or mechanical characteristics.

Engineering Selection Recommendations
The 91615-312LF is the direct functional equivalent of the 91615-312. Both parts are electrically and mechanically identical across all specified parameters. Selection between these parts should be based on the following factors:
For new designs and active production: The 91615-312LF is the appropriate choice. It maintains active product status with Amphenol ICC, ensuring ongoing availability and supply chain stability. The part is RoHS compliant and REACH affected, meeting current regulatory requirements for most applications in automotive, industrial, telecommunications, and general purpose markets.
For legacy system maintenance: The 91615-312 remains functionally compatible with existing assemblies. However, due to obsolete status, sourcing may be limited. The 91615-312LF provides identical performance and can be substituted directly in repair and maintenance scenarios.
Compliance considerations: The 91615-312LF's RoHS compliance and REACH affected status align with modern regulatory frameworks. Organizations subject to RoHS or REACH requirements should prioritize the 91615-312LF for new applications.
Frequently Asked Questions (FAQ)
Q: Are the 91615-312 and 91615-312LF mechanically interchangeable?
A: Yes. Both parts share identical connector geometry, pitch spacing (0.100"), number of positions (24), mounting type (surface mount), and mated stacking height (10.81mm). They are direct mechanical substitutes with no PCB layout or assembly modifications required.
Q: What is the difference between these two part numbers?
A: The primary differences are product status and regulatory compliance. The 91615-312 is obsolete and RoHS non-compliant, while the 91615-312LF is active and RoHS compliant. All electrical and mechanical specifications are identical.
Q: Can I use the 91615-312LF as a drop-in replacement for the 91615-312?
A: Yes. The 91615-312LF is a direct functional and mechanical equivalent. No design changes, PCB modifications, or assembly procedure adjustments are necessary.
Q: What does the "LF" suffix in 91615-312LF indicate?
A: The "LF" designation indicates lead-free construction, which is associated with RoHS compliance. This part meets RoHS requirements for restricted substance limitations.
Q: Are there any electrical performance differences between these parts?
A: No. Both parts have identical contact materials (phosphor bronze), contact finishes (gold mating, tin post), and physical dimensions. Electrical performance is equivalent.
Q: What packaging is available for the 91615-312LF?
A: The 91615-312LF is supplied in tube packaging. The original 91615-312 packaging specification was not provided in the technical data.
Q: Which part should I specify for new designs?
A: Specify the 91615-312LF for new designs. It is the active product with current regulatory compliance and assured supply chain availability.
